Umbrella & Sahalie Falls with side trip to Timberline Trail
This is a fun loop with a side trail up to the Timberline Trail via Mt Hood Meadows. The loop can be done either clockwise or counterclockwise, but the preference is to hike it counterclockwise. Start at the Elk Meadows trailhead and if you time it right in August, you will enjoy ripe hickleberries as you make your way up to the left turnoff at trail #667 which leads to Umbrella Falls. After visiting the falls, you can take the 1.7 mile optional trail up to the Timberline Trail by crossing over the paved road that leads to the Mt Hood Meadows upper ski area. Find the trail that leads to the Timberline Trail just north of the new maintenance building hidden in the woods. When you return back to Umbrella Falls, look for the sign that is marked #667C that will lead you down to Sahalie Falls and back to your vehicle.
